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

Advanced life support, level 2 (als 2)

Advanced Life Support Level 2 (ALS 2) is a medical service provided during emergencies. It involves advanced procedures like defibrillation, medication administration or endotracheal intubation by trained professionals to stabilize critical patients.

This service was performed 21 times for 18 patients

Ambulance service, advanced life support, emergency transport, level 1 (als 1 - emergency)

Ambulance Service, Advanced Life Support, Level 1 (ALS 1 - Emergency) is a critical care transport service for emergency situations. It includes a team of healthcare professionals equipped with advanced skills and tools to manage life-threatening conditions during transport.

This service was performed 408 times for 275 patients

Ambulance service, basic life support, emergency transport (bls-emergency)

Ambulance service with basic life support (BLS-Emergency) provides immediate transport for patients in critical situations. Medical professionals on board deliver essential care like CPR, wound dressing, and oxygen therapy to stabilize patients during the journey.

This service was performed 417 times for 246 patients

Ground mileage, per statute mile

Ground mileage per statute mile is a method of calculating the cost of transportation for medical services. It is used when a patient needs to be transported by ground ambulance. The cost is calculated per mile, from the pick-up location to the medical facility.

This service was performed 13,511 times for 433 patients

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1992369110, we treat the final digit (0)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 70.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 70 = 0).
